on thursday jane & i tried by canoe & i think successfully made the first
known class b visit in history to the ohio pennsylvania west virginia or
ohpawv tristate point situated in a heavily industrial area of & within
the ohio river

like we were out there too among the barges & cranes & derricks

this point is coincidentally also the northernmost one in west virginia
& the last wet tristate i could hope to own without a gps & more of a boat


we also made our way to the position of the modern successor point of the
original but now lost point of beginning of the public land system

the usgs indicates this modern day section corner as a point on dry land
scarcely 250 feet north of the combined ohpawv & wvn point within the river
yet itself high & dry & well within the large industrial compound that is
shown at the bottom of the present corner corner page
& i found this whole general target area unmarked
as well as heavily asphalted over & piled high with industrial commodities
for hundreds of feet in all directions

but perhaps our most rewarding adventure of the outing was a successful
unassisted snakumnavigation of the entire new york pennsylvania boundary
line

by that i mean we followed & visited this roughly 300 mile border at all of
its roughly 180 road crossings
between its new jersey or southern terminus
at njnypa
aka njn or northernmost new jersey
& its lake erie or northwest terminus
at the northernmost dry point of pennsylvania
aka dry pan
all without maps or gps or compass nor even sunshine frequently
& by dead reckoning & discernment alone of such traces as gravel changes etc
for the great majority of the way was in wilderness on unimproved roads
while recovering dozens of roadstones & other monuments

these included all 4 major witness stones of this boundary
situated near both termini & both of the turn points
which latter also happen to double as the so called northeast corner of
pennsylvania & southwest corner of new york successively
